New family visits exchange between Tindouf Camps and Southern Provinces 2/9/2009
The operation of family exchange visits led by the High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) between the camps of Tindouf, southern Algeria and southern provinces of the Kingdom, continued Friday with the organization of 5th trip for the year 2009, to and from the province of Laayoune. This exchange was attended by 59 beneficiaries belonging to 15 families, said a press release from the Office of the Moroccan Coordination with MINURSO.

UNSG voices hope to see progress in Sahara issue 2/3/2009
The UN Secretary-General, Ban Ki-moon, voiced hope, here Monday, to see progress achieved in the Sahara issue during the upcoming negotiations.The UNSG voiced his "sincere hope to see progress achieved" in the Sahara issue with the appointment of Christopher Ross as a new special envoy. He said new negotiations will be shortly launched, but specified neither the date, nor the venue of these upcoming negotiations.
